## Configuration

Gatepost enforces per-client rate limits. Defaults: 100 req/s burst, 40 sustained. Override with GATEPOST_BURST and GATEPOST_SUSTAINED in the service .env. Limits are tracked in the shared counter store; without it, the gateway fails open. The counter store requires authentication. Add the credential to your .env as a single line:

env line for yajep-bajof: ARCHIVE_KEY3=015

Memo to the Board — Ferncliff Partner Term Sheet

Quick update: we've received a term sheet from Orvale Dynamics covering the proposed co-development of the Skylark module. Headline terms are reasonable — shared IP on new work, exclusivity limited to two years, and a modest upfront commitment from their side. Counsel flagged the audit-rights clause as overly broad; we're pushing back. The confidential note below sets out how this fits our business plans.

internal memo for yahag-tahog: The pricing group signed off on a budget of $152.8 million for Project Soriel.

## Deploying the Gatewick Proctor Queue

Deploys are pretty painless: push to main, wait for the pipeline, then watch the queue drain dashboard for five minutes. If candidates pile up mid-exam, roll back first and ask questions later — the queue replays safely. Everything the workers care about lives in one config block, shown here for reference.

settings of bafof-yagef:
JOROX_PIN=8740
JOROX_TENANT=pelox
JOROX_METRICS_HOST=metrics.jorox.qorvelworks.internal
JOROX_SEAL=seal_c78f63c1
JOROX_STANDBY_TEAM=norax

**Ticket DG-77: Graph visualizer fails to connect after idle timeout**

New folks: the Mapleloom dependency graph visualizer holds a single long-lived database session. After roughly ten idle minutes, the server drops it and the UI shows an empty canvas instead of reconnecting. We need a retry-with-backoff wrapper. Reproduce locally against the metrics database using the connection string below.

database URL for tajog-bajeg: mysql://soreth_svc:OzsCjhu@db-6997.nelvrostack.internal:5432/kelax